At <strong>Teflon X<\/strong>, we\u2019ve moved past the \u201cone size fits all\u201d mentality because, let\u2019s be honest, every turbo setup has its own personality quirks.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\">Why Turbochargers Eat Gaskets for Breakfast<\/h2>\n\n\n\n<p>Let\u2019s get technical but keep it real. A turbocharger is basically a heat pump. The turbine side is driven by exhaust gases. We aren\u2019t talking about a warm summer breeze here; we are talking about exhaust gas temperatures (EGTs) that frequently hit <strong>800\u00b0C to 1050\u00b0C<\/strong> (that\u2019s roughly 1472\u00b0F to 1922\u00b0F for the imperial folks).<\/p>\n\n\n\n<p>While the gasket usually isn\u2019t sitting directly in the exhaust stream (unless it\u2019s the turbine inlet\/outlet gasket), the heat soak is massive. The entire housing expands.<\/p>\n\n\n\n<p>Here is the problem: <strong>Thermal Cycling.<\/strong><br>The metal expands when hot and shrinks when cool. The gasket gets crushed, then released, then crushed again.<br>Most materials take a \u201ccompression set.\u201d This means after they get squished, they stay squished. When the gap opens up during cooling? Leak city.<\/p>\n\n\n\n<p><strong>High temp gaskets<\/strong> need to do two things:<\/p>\n\n\n\n<ol class=\"wp-block-list\">\n<li>Survive the heat without turning into goo or ash.<\/li>\n\n\n\n<li>Bounce back (recover) when the flange moves.<\/li>\n<\/ol>\n\n\n\n<h3 class=\"wp-block-heading\">Fisika di Balik Kegagalan<\/h3>\n\n\n\n<p>Jika kita melihat tegangan pada gasket, bentuknya kira-kira seperti ini dalam matematika teks yang disederhanakan:<\/p>\n\n\n\n<p>Tegangan (S) = Gaya (F) \/ Luas (A)<\/p>\n\n\n\n<p>Dalam aplikasi turbo, <em>Gaya<\/em> tidak konstan. Bukan hanya karena itu ada dalam nama kami.<\/p>\n\n\n\n<p>PTFE memiliki titik leleh sekitar <strong>327\u00b0C (620\u00b0F)<\/strong>. Meskipun itu lebih rendah dari puncak EGT sebuah turbo, ingatlah, gasket pada sisi kompresor atau saluran pembuangan oli tidak terpapar langsung oleh api. Untuk saluran oli dan pendingin yang terhubung ke turbo, atau intake plenum, PTFE secara virtual bersifat inert secara kimiawi. Ia tidak terpengaruh oleh oli panas, bahan bakar balap, atau metanol.<\/p>\n\n\n\n<p>Berikut adalah rincian singkat mengapa kami menggunakannya dibandingkan dengan bahan lainnya:<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">Perbandingan Material: Tes \u201cApakah Akan Meleleh?\u201d<\/h3>\n\n\n\n<p>Saya menyusun tabel ini berdasarkan data yang telah kami kumpulkan selama bertahun-tahun pengujian.<\/p>\n\n\n\n<figure class=\"wp-block-table\"><table class=\"has-fixed-layout\"><thead><tr><th class=\"has-text-align-left\" data-align=\"left\">Bahan<\/th><th class=\"has-text-align-left\" data-align=\"left\">Suhu Kontinu Maks<\/th><th class=\"has-text-align-left\" data-align=\"left\">Ketahanan Oli<\/th><th class=\"has-text-align-left\" data-align=\"left\">Set Kompresi<\/th><th class=\"has-text-align-left\" data-align=\"left\">Terbaik Untuk<\/th><\/tr><\/thead><tbody><tr><td class=\"has-text-align-left\" data-align=\"left\"><strong>PTFE perawan<\/strong><\/td><td class=\"has-text-align-left\" data-align=\"left\">260\u00b0C (500\u00b0F)<\/td><td class=\"has-text-align-left\" data-align=\"left\">Bagus sekali<\/td><td class=\"has-text-align-left\" data-align=\"left\">Buruk (Cold flow)<\/td><td class=\"has-text-align-left\" data-align=\"left\">Jalur kimia, tekanan rendah<\/td><\/tr><tr><td class=\"has-text-align-left\" data-align=\"left\"><strong>PTFE Berisi Kaca<\/strong><\/td><td class=\"has-text-align-left\" data-align=\"left\">260\u00b0C (500\u00b0F)<\/td><td class=\"has-text-align-left\" data-align=\"left\">Bagus sekali<\/td><td class=\"has-text-align-left\" data-align=\"left\">Bagus<\/td><td class=\"has-text-align-left\" data-align=\"left\"><strong>Jalur oli\/pendingin turbo<\/strong><\/td><\/tr><tr><td class=\"has-text-align-left\" data-align=\"left\"><strong>PTFE Berisi Karbon<\/strong><\/td><td class=\"has-text-align-left\" data-align=\"left\">260\u00b0C+<\/td><td class=\"has-text-align-left\" data-align=\"left\">Bagus sekali<\/td><td class=\"has-text-align-left\" data-align=\"left\">Sangat baik<\/td><td class=\"has-text-align-left\" data-align=\"left\">Permukaan panas tinggi<\/td><\/tr><tr><td class=\"has-text-align-left\" data-align=\"left\"><strong>NBR (Karet)<\/strong><\/td><td class=\"has-text-align-left\" data-align=\"left\">120\u00b0C (248\u00b0F)<\/td><td class=\"has-text-align-left\" data-align=\"left\">Bagus<\/td><td class=\"has-text-align-left\" data-align=\"left\">Bagus<\/td><td class=\"has-text-align-left\" data-align=\"left\">Hanya untuk intake sisi dingin<\/td><\/tr><tr><td class=\"has-text-align-left\" data-align=\"left\"><strong>Grafit<\/strong><\/td><td class=\"has-text-align-left\" data-align=\"left\">450\u00b0C+<\/td><td class=\"has-text-align-left\" data-align=\"left\">Adil<\/td><td class=\"has-text-align-left\" data-align=\"left\">Bagus sekali<\/td><td class=\"has-text-align-left\" data-align=\"left\">Flensa knalpot<\/td><\/tr><\/tbody><\/table><\/figure>\n\n\n\n<p>Anda akan melihat bahwa saya mencantumkan \"Virgin PTFE\" memiliki set kompresi yang buruk. Itulah masalah \"cold flow\" atau \"creep\" (rayapan). Jika Anda mengencangkannya, material tersebut akan tertekuk keluar dari samping seperti pasta gigi seiring waktu.<\/p>\n\n\n\n<p><strong>Opini Kontroversial:<\/strong> Berhenti menggunakan Virgin PTFE untuk flensa bertekanan tinggi. Berhentilah sekarang. Harganya murah, tapi menyebalkan. Anda memerlukan <strong>Custom PTFE Gaskets<\/strong> yang diperkuat. Kami menggunakan pengisi seperti Kaca, Karbon, atau Perunggu untuk menghentikan creep. Ini memberikan \"tulang\" pada gasket.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\">Merancang Gasket PTFE Kustom untuk Rakitan Anda<\/h2>\n\n\n\n<p>Saat Anda datang kepada kami untuk <strong>gasket potong khusus<\/strong>, kami tidak hanya mengambil selembar material dan memotongnya secara sembarangan. Kami menjaga bilah pisau kami tetap tajam.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\">Tips Pemasangan (Jangan Sampai Salah)<\/h2>\n\n\n\n<p>Bahkan yang terbaik sekalipun <strong>solusi penyegelan otomotif<\/strong> akan gagal jika dipasang secara kasar.<\/p>\n\n\n\n<ol class=\"wp-block-list\">\n<li><strong>Bersihkan Flensa:<\/strong> Maksud saya, benar-benar bersih. Sisa material gasket lama, oli, karat. Bersihkan hingga ke logam dasar.<\/li>\n\n\n\n<li><strong>Pemasangan Kering:<\/strong> PTFE umumnya tidak memerlukan silikon RTV. Faktanya, silikon sering kali berfungsi sebagai pelumas yang membantu paking terlepas. Pasang dalam keadaan kering kecuali jika kami tentukan sebaliknya.<\/li>\n\n\n\n<li><strong>Urutan Torsi:<\/strong> Pola silang. Selalu.<\/li>\n\n\n\n<li><strong>Torsi Ulang:<\/strong> Ini adalah bagian yang krusial. PTFE mengalami relaksasi. Setelah siklus panas pertama (nyalakan mesin, biarkan panas, biarkan dingin), periksa baut kembali. Anda kemungkinan akan bisa memutar baut seperempat putaran lagi.<\/li>\n<\/ol>\n\n\n\n<h2 class=\"wp-block-heading\">FAQ: Pertanyaan yang Sering Diajukan kepada Saya di Bar<\/h2>\n\n\n<div id=\"rank-math-faq\" class=\"rank-math-block\">\n<div class=\"rank-math-list\">\n<div id=\"faq-question-1770731621318\" class=\"rank-math-list-item\">\n<h3 class=\"rank-math-question\"><strong>T: Bisakah saya menggunakan PTFE untuk paking manifold buang?<\/strong><\/h3>\n<div class=\"rank-math-answer\">\n\n<p><strong>A:<\/strong> Sejujurnya? Biasanya tidak. PTFE terdegradasi di atas 260\u00b0C (500\u00b0F). Header knalpot mencapai suhu 800\u00b0C+. Untuk itu, Anda memerlukan baja berlapis (MLS) atau grafit. Namun untuk <em>segala hal lainnya<\/em> yang terpasang pada turbo (saluran oli, saluran pendingin, rumah kompresor, intake), PTFE adalah pilihan terbaik.<\/p>\n\n<\/div>\n<\/div>\n<div id=\"faq-question-1770731622486\" class=\"rank-math-list-item\">\n<h3 class=\"rank-math-question\"><strong>T: Mengapa gasket kustom lebih mahal daripada yang ada di eBay?<\/strong><\/h3>\n<div class=\"rank-math-answer\">\n\n<p><strong>A:<\/strong> Karena produk di eBay mungkin bertuliskan \u201cPTFE\u201d tetapi sering kali hanya plastik murah yang meleleh pada suhu 150\u00b0C.
